I really feel like one of the biggest detriments of CR:K's story format is that:
It is sometimes hard to keep track of who knows what information.
It is confusing to know whether or not they believe that information/what they think on it.
This post is mostly gonna talk about some of the recent reactions to the Timeline of Fate episodes - complaining about things that were assumed to be secrets were actually glossed over/common knowledge/shared off-screen.
Mainly pertaining to the Witches eating Cookies being casually discussed by PV and the Brave Trio being made by a Witch.
Now, in my own AU's, I typically have these things be secrets for the conflict/intrigue that this information brings.
However, canon has hinted at this not exactly being the case.
Firstly, Dark Enchantress's earliest interaction with the Ancients that we see (the opening of the game when you first start playing), is literally her proclaiming that Cookies were made to be eaten. And she stated it multiple times throughout Act 1. However we never really got much in terms of real debate from the opposing party.
"Cookies were made to be eaten!"
The way this is phrased is kind of deceptive. Because its possible they're not actually debating on whether or not Witches eat Cookies AT ALL. They're arguing about WHY cookies were made in the first place. Was it truly to be eaten? Or are the ones who eat cookies bad actors who are harming the cookies in a way that was never intended?
Either way, i think most people walked away from that thinking that the Ancient Heroes just straight-up didn't believe Dark Enchantress AT ALL. Like she was spouting some crazy insane tin-foil hat conspiracy shit. (Which would be fucking HILARIOUS tbh)
I do kind of wish the Ancients had more time to actually express their beliefs or at least express their knowledge on this topic a bit clearer.
The visual novel style of the game is super limited. Thus we don't have the luxury of seeing character body language or subtle details in the backgrounds - like you'd see in a TV series or something.
